Notteri Pond, Cagliari

Lake Notteri is a pond that is located in the central part of the peninsula of Capo Carbonara, in the Villasimius district. The area of the lake is 34 hectares, and the depth is no more than 1.5 meters. Attention deserves snow-white fine sand and sea water. Such a landscape is very popular not only among tourists – on the shore of Lake Notteri films and commercials are often made.
Nature of Notteri Pond
Lake Notteri was formed due to the connection of the island of Punta Santo Stefano with the land through two braids. As a result of this process, part of the sea was fenced and turned into a pond. The lake is drainless, therefore in the summer time there is a sharp drop in the water level. Notteri replenishes its waters due to precipitation. The water in the lake is salty.
The fauna of the salt lake of Notteri is represented by gulls, cormorants and other swamp birds. In winter, flamingos flock there. The lake is one of the few places on the east coast of Sardinia where you can meet these birds. Such inhabitants attract tourists and are a real tourist pearl of the peninsula of Capo Carbonara.

How to get there
The nearest airport to the lake is Cagliari, here planes fly from many Italian and European cities. The Peninsula of Capo Carbonara is in 50 km from the airport. Also, ferries from other ports of the Mediterranean Sea arrive at the port of Cagliari.
From Cagliari, tourist can get by car. For this it is necessary to proceed along the Quartu-Sant Elena – Villasimius highway. In 2 km to the town of Villasimius, turn right onto the road to Campulung. On this road it is necessary to follow up to the fork in Villasimius. Turning on it, the tourist gets on the road, which leads to the pond.
